About the Role

We are looking for a Senior QA Engineer to take ownership of quality across web, mobile, and API platforms. This role focuses on designing and executing a balanced QA strategy that combines strong automation with effective manual testing.

You will play a key role in ensuring reliable authentication flows, critical user journeys, and high‑quality releases by embedding testing into the development lifecycle and CI/CD pipelines. The role suits someone who is detail‑oriented, thorough, and comfortable operating in a balanced, collaborative working style.

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and maintain automated test suites covering functional, regression, and integration testing.
  • Implement and maintain automated regression test runs integrated into CI/CD pipelines.
  • Ensure coverage of authentication flows, API endpoints, and critical user journeys.
  • Collaborate with developers to implement and support unit testing frameworks.
  • Execute manual exploratory testing to complement and extend automated coverage.
  • Perform cross-browser, cross-device, and responsive design testing.
  • Conduct API testing using appropriate tools and frameworks.
  • Execute performance and load testing for critical user journeys.
  • Test secure authentication and identity flows, including OAuth, SAML, and Azure AD B2C.
  • Develop and implement comprehensive QA strategies combining manual and automated approaches.
  • Create and maintain test plans based on user stories, acceptance criteria, and technical requirements.
  • Define test scope, objectives, success metrics, quality gates, and exit criteria across the development lifecycle.
  • Own the regression testing strategy and perform impact analysis for new features.
Requirements
  • 5+ years of experience in Software QA.
  • 2+ years of experience with test automation, using Selenium, Cypress, or Playwright.
  • 2+ years of hands‑on manual testing experience.
  • Proven experience designing and maintaining automated test suites.
  • Experience integrating automated testing into CI/CD pipelines.
  • Strong understanding of API testing and authentication/identity flows.
  • Comfortable working across web, mobile, and API‑based systems.
  • Detail‑oriented and thorough, with a strong focus on execution and reliability.
  • Balanced working style, able to collaborate effectively while owning deliverables independently.
Nice to Have
  • Experience with performance and load testing tools.
  • Exposure to secure identity systems such as OAuth, SAML, or Azure AD B2C.
  • Experience contributing to QA process improvements and test strategy definition.
